Wood Spice Chest with (6) Handpainted Ceramic Drawers – Folk Art Style

This handcrafted wooden spice chest features six individually hand-painted ceramic drawers, each adorned with colorful floral and geometric motifs. The folk-art-inspired patterns and vivid glazes are reminiscent of traditional Mexican Talavera pottery. A solid wood frame with a warm finish provides a sturdy base and a handsome contrast to the bright ceramic drawer fronts.

Compact and functional, this decorative chest is ideal for storing spices, small kitchen items, tea bags, or even jewelry and crafting supplies. Its charming design brings a touch of artisanal color and character to any countertop, vanity, or shelf.
